【NPU】Ascend Docker Runtime v26.0.1 之三 runtime/dcmi/ — 超深度逐行分析

runtime/dcmi/ --- 超深度逐行分析

三个文件:dcmi.go (360行) + dcmi_api.go (101行) + dcManager.go (294行) = 755行

核心职责:NPU设备管理接口封装,通过CGO调用libdcmi.so


一、模块定位

1.1 业务职责

runtime/dcmi/ 是设备管理抽象层,负责:

  1. 驱动版本自适应 --- 自动检测V1/V2驱动,选择匹配的Worker
  2. 设备查询 --- 获取卡列表、设备列表、芯片信息、产品类型
  3. 虚拟设备管理 --- 创建/销毁vNPU(虚拟NPU切分)
  4. 物理ID↔逻辑ID转换 --- 将用户指定的物理设备ID转换为驱动内部逻辑ID
  5. CGO桥接 --- 封装所有对libdcmi.so的C语言调用

二、dcmi_api.go 逐行解析(101行)

2.1 数据结构

go 复制代码
type VDeviceInfo struct {
    CardID    int32
    DeviceID  int32
    VdeviceID int32
}
字段 含义 示例
CardID NPU卡ID(物理插槽) 0
DeviceID 卡内设备ID 1
VdeviceID 虚拟设备ID(切分后生成) 42

2.2 WorkerInterface 接口

go 复制代码
type WorkerInterface interface {
    Initialize() error
    ShutDown()
    CreateVDevice(uniqueID int32, coreNum string) (VDeviceInfo, error)
    DestroyVDevice(uniqueID int32, vDevID int32) error
    GetProductType() (string, error)
    GetChipName() (string, error)
}

6个方法的职责

方法 输入 输出 用途
Initialize error 初始化dcmi库连接
ShutDown 关闭dcmi库连接
CreateVDevice uniqueID(物理设备ID), coreNum(切分模板) VDeviceInfo, error 创建虚拟NPU
DestroyVDevice uniqueID, vDevID(虚拟设备ID) error 销毁虚拟NPU
GetProductType string, error 获取产品型号
GetChipName string, error 获取芯片名称

设计意图:策略模式接口,V1和V2驱动各自实现此接口,调用方无需关心驱动版本。

2.3 CreateVDevice 顶层API

go 复制代码
func CreateVDevice(w WorkerInterface, spec *specs.Spec, devices []int) (VDeviceInfo, error) {
    invalidVDevice := VDeviceInfo{CardID: -1, DeviceID: -1, VdeviceID: -1}
    if spec == nil {
        return invalidVDevice, fmt.Errorf("spec is nil")
    }
    splitDevice, err := extractVpuParam(spec)
    if err != nil {
        return invalidVDevice, err
    }
    if splitDevice == "" {
        return invalidVDevice, nil
    }
    if len(devices) != 1 || devices[0] < 0 || devices[0] >= hiAIMaxCardNum*hiAIMaxDeviceNum {
        hwlog.RunLog.Errorf("invalid devices: %v", devices)
        return invalidVDevice, fmt.Errorf("invalid devices: %v", devices)
    }

    if err := w.Initialize(); err != nil {
        return invalidVDevice, fmt.Errorf("cannot init dcmi : %v", err)
    }
    defer w.ShutDown()

    vDeviceInfo, err := w.CreateVDevice(int32(devices[0]), splitDevice)
    if err != nil || vDeviceInfo.VdeviceID < 0 {
        hwlog.RunLog.Errorf("cannot create vd or vdevice is wrong: %v %v", vDeviceInfo.VdeviceID, err)
        return invalidVDevice, err
    }
    return vDeviceInfo, nil
}

逐行解析

  1. 定义无效返回值 invalidVDevice(所有ID为-1)
  2. nil检查保护
  3. extractVpuParam --- 从OCI Spec环境变量中提取vNPU切分模板
  4. 如果splitDevice为空 → 不是虚拟模式,返回无效值但无错误
  5. 设备数校验 :vNPU切分只允许1个物理设备(len(devices) != 1),且ID在有效范围内
  6. 初始化Worker → 创建虚拟设备 → defer关闭
  7. 如果创建失败或VdeviceID<0 → 返回错误

设计意图:此函数是对Worker.CreateVDevice的包装,增加了Spec解析和参数校验。

2.4 extractVpuParam --- vNPU切分模板解析

go 复制代码
func extractVpuParam(spec *specs.Spec) (string, error) {
    allowSplit := map[string]string{
        "vir01": "vir01", "vir02": "vir02", "vir04": "vir04", "vir08": "vir08", "vir16": "vir16",
        "vir02_1c": "vir02_1c", "vir03_1c_8g": "vir03_1c_8g", "vir04_3c": "vir04_3c",
        "vir04_4c_dvpp": "vir04_4c_dvpp", "vir04_3c_ndvpp": "vir04_3c_ndvpp",
        "vir05_1c_8g": "vir05_1c_8g", "vir05_1c_16g": "vir05_1c_16g",
        "vir06_1c_16g": "vir06_1c_16g", "vir10_3c_16g": "vir10_3c_16g",
        "vir10_3c_16g_nm": "vir10_3c_16g_nm", "vir10_3c_32g": "vir10_3c_32g",
        "vir10_4c_16g_m": "vir10_4c_16g_m", "vir12_3c_32g": "vir12_3c_32g",
    }

    for _, line := range spec.Process.Env {
        words := strings.Split(line, "=")
        const LENGTH int = 2
        if len(words) != LENGTH {
            continue
        }
        if strings.TrimSpace(words[0]) == api.AscendVnpuSpescEnv {
            if split, ok := allowSplit[words[1]]; ok && split != "" {
                return split, nil
            }
            return "", fmt.Errorf("cannot parse param : %v", words[1])
        }
    }
    return "", nil
}

vNPU切分模板说明

模板名 含义
vir01 1/16切分(最小)
vir02 1/8切分
vir04 1/4切分
vir08 1/2切分
vir16 不切分(全卡)
vir02_1c 1/8切分+1核
vir04_3c 1/4切分+3核
vir04_4c_dvpp 1/4切分+4核+DVPP
vir04_3c_ndvpp 1/4切分+3核+无DVPP
vir05_1c_8g 1/3.2切分+1核+8GB
vir10_3c_16g 1/1.6切分+3核+16GB
vir10_4c_16g_m 1/1.6切分+4核+16GB+内存增强
vir12_3c_32g 1/1.3切分+3核+32GB

逐行解析

  1. 定义允许的切分模板白名单(map)
  2. 遍历容器环境变量
  3. 找到 ASCEND_VNPU_SPECS 环境变量
  4. 如果值在白名单中 → 返回切分模板
  5. 如果值不在白名单 → 返回错误(防止非法切分参数)
  6. 如果环境变量不存在 → 返回空字符串(非虚拟模式)

设计意图:严格的白名单校验,防止用户传入非法切分参数导致驱动异常。


三、dcmi.go 逐行解析(360行)

3.1 常量定义

go 复制代码
const (
    retError           = -1
    hiAIMaxCardNum     = 64           // 最大卡数
    hiAIMaxCardID      = math.MaxInt32 // 卡ID上限
    hiAIMaxDeviceID    = math.MaxInt32 // 设备ID上限
    hiAIMaxDeviceNum   = 4             // 每卡最大设备数
    maxChipNameLen     = 32            // 芯片名最大长度
    productTypeLen     = 64            // 产品类型最大长度
    notSupportCode     = -8255         // "不支持"错误码
    coreNumLen         = 32            // 切分模板名最大长度
    vfgID              = 4294967295    // 虚拟组ID默认值(0xFFFFFFFF)
    notSupportString   = "[not support]"
)
常量 用途
hiAIMaxCardNum 64 系统最多支持64张NPU卡
hiAIMaxDeviceNum 4 每张卡最多4个芯片
maxChipNameLen 32 C结构体中芯片名字段长度
vfgID 0xFFFFFFFF 虚拟功能组ID,默认自动分配
notSupportCode -8255 DCMI库返回的"不支持"错误码

3.2 managerList --- Worker注册表

go 复制代码
var managerList = []WorkerInterface{
    &NpuV1Worker{DcMgr: &DcV1Manager{}},
    &NpuV2Worker{DcMgr: &DcV2Manager{}},
}

设计意图 :全局Worker列表,V1在前V2在后。GetMatchingNpuWorker 按顺序尝试初始化,第一个成功的即为匹配的驱动版本。

3.3 ChipInfo 结构体

go 复制代码
type ChipInfo struct {
    Type    string `json:"chip_type"`
    Name    string `json:"chip_name"`
    Version string `json:"chip_version"`
}
  • 从C结构体 DcmiChipInfo 转换而来
  • Name 用于判断芯片类型(如"Ascend910A"→Ascend910)

3.4 驱动接口定义

go 复制代码
type DcDriverV1Interface interface {
    DcInitialize() error
    DcShutDown()
    DcGetCardList() (int32, []int32, error)
    DcGetDeviceNumInCard(cardID int32) (int32, error)
    DcGetDeviceLogicID(cardID, deviceID int32) (int32, error)
    DcGetProductType(cardID, deviceID int32) (string, error)
    DcCreateVDevice(cardID, deviceID int32, coreNum string) (int32, error)
    DcDestroyVDevice(cardID, deviceID int32, vDevID int32) error
    DcGetChipInfo(cardID, deviceID int32) (*ChipInfo, error)
    DcGetDeviceLogicidFromPhyid(phyID int32) (int32, error)
}

type DcDriverV2Interface interface {
    DcInitialize() error
    DcShutDown()
    DcCreateVDevice(deviceID int32, coreNum string) (int32, error)
    DcDestroyVDevice(deviceID int32, vDevID int32) error
    DcGetChipInfo(deviceID int32) (*ChipInfo, error)
    DcGetDeviceList() (int32, []int32, error)
}

V1 vs V2 接口差异

差异点 V1 V2
设备寻址 cardID + deviceID 二级寻址 deviceID 一级寻址
卡列表 DcGetCardList → 每卡DcGetDeviceNumInCard DcGetDeviceList 直接获取所有设备
产品类型 支持 DcGetProductType 不支持(返回"not support")
物理ID转换 DcGetDeviceLogicidFromPhyid 不需要(直接用deviceID)
虚拟设备 支持 不支持(返回错误)

3.5 GetMatchingNpuWorker --- 工厂函数

go 复制代码
func GetMatchingNpuWorker() (WorkerInterface, error) {
    for _, manager := range managerList {
        err := manager.Initialize()
        if err == nil {
            manager.ShutDown()
            hwlog.RunLog.Infof("worker type: %T", manager)
            return manager, nil
        }
    }
    return nil, fmt.Errorf("failed to find a valid manager")
}

逐行解析

  1. 遍历managerList:先尝试V1,再尝试V2
  2. 调用 Initialize() 尝试初始化dcmi库
  3. 如果成功 → 立即 ShutDown()(因为只是探测,实际使用时会重新初始化)
  4. 返回匹配的Worker
  5. 如果都失败 → 返回错误

设计意图 :V1调用 DcmiInit(),V2调用 DcmiV2Init()。在新版硬件上调用V1初始化会失败,反之亦然。利用这个特性来自动检测驱动版本。

3.6 NpuV1Worker.FindDevice --- 物理ID到卡/设备映射

go 复制代码
func (w *NpuV1Worker) FindDevice(visibleDevice int32) (int32, int32, error) {
    targetLogicID, err := w.DcMgr.DcGetDeviceLogicidFromPhyid(visibleDevice)
    if err != nil {
        return 0, 0, fmt.Errorf("cannot convert phy id to logic id, err: %v", err)
    }
    _, cardList, err := w.DcMgr.DcGetCardList()
    if err != nil {
        return 0, 0, fmt.Errorf("get card list err : %v", err)
    }
    targetDeviceID, targetCardID := int32(math.MaxInt32), int32(math.MaxInt32)
    for _, cardID := range cardList {
        deviceCount, err := w.DcMgr.DcGetDeviceNumInCard(cardID)
        if err != nil {
            return 0, 0, fmt.Errorf("cannot get device num in card : %v", err)
        }
        for deviceID := int32(0); deviceID < deviceCount; deviceID++ {
            logicID, err := w.DcMgr.DcGetDeviceLogicID(cardID, deviceID)
            if err != nil {
                return 0, 0, fmt.Errorf("cannot get logic id : %v", err)
            }
            if logicID == targetLogicID {
                targetCardID, targetDeviceID = cardID, deviceID
            }
        }
    }
    return targetDeviceID, targetCardID, nil
}

逐行解析

  1. 将物理ID(用户指定的visibleDevice)转换为逻辑ID
  2. 获取所有卡的列表
  3. 双层遍历:遍历每张卡,遍历卡内每个设备
  4. 对每个设备获取其逻辑ID
  5. 如果逻辑ID匹配目标 → 记录cardID和deviceID
  6. 返回找到的deviceID和cardID

设计意图 :V1驱动使用"物理ID"作为用户接口(如ASCEND_VISIBLE_DEVICES=0),但内部操作需要cardID+deviceID二维坐标。此函数完成这个映射。

3.7 NpuV1Worker.GetChipName

go 复制代码
func (w *NpuV1Worker) GetChipName() (string, error) {
    invalidName := ""

    if err := w.Initialize(); err != nil {
        return invalidName, fmt.Errorf("cannot init dcmi : %v", err)
    }
    defer w.ShutDown()

    cardNum, cardList, err := w.DcMgr.DcGetCardList()
    if err != nil {
        return invalidName, err
    }
    if cardNum == 0 {
        return invalidName, fmt.Errorf("get chip info failed, no card found")
    }

    for _, cardID := range cardList {
        devNum, err := w.DcMgr.DcGetDeviceNumInCard(cardID)
        if err != nil || devNum == 0 {
            continue
        }
        for devID := int32(0); devID < devNum; devID++ {
            chipInfo, err := w.DcMgr.DcGetChipInfo(cardID, devID)
            if err != nil {
                continue
            }
            if !isValidChipInfo(chipInfo) {
                continue
            }
            return (*chipInfo).Name, nil
        }
    }

    return invalidName, fmt.Errorf("cannot get valid chip info")
}

执行流程

  1. 初始化dcmi → 获取卡列表 → 遍历卡 → 遍历设备 → 获取芯片信息 → 返回第一个有效芯片名
  2. 容错策略:任何单步失败都continue跳过,继续尝试下一个设备
  3. defer确保关闭dcmi连接

设计意图:只需要获取任意一个有效芯片的名称即可确定整个系统的芯片类型(假设同一机器上芯片类型一致)。

3.8 NpuV2Worker.GetChipName

go 复制代码
func (a *NpuV2Worker) GetChipName() (string, error) {
    invalidName := ""

    if err := a.Initialize(); err != nil {
        return invalidName, fmt.Errorf("cannot init dcmi : %v", err)
    }
    defer a.ShutDown()

    deviceNum, deviceList, err := a.DcMgr.DcGetDeviceList()
    // ...
    for _, devID := range deviceList {
        chipInfo, err := a.DcMgr.DcGetChipInfo(devID)
        // ...
        return (*chipInfo).Name, nil
    }
    return invalidName, fmt.Errorf("cannot get valid chip info")
}

与V1的区别

  • V1:卡列表→每卡设备数→遍历cardID+deviceID
  • V2:直接获取设备列表→遍历deviceID

3.9 NpuV1Worker.CreateVDevice

go 复制代码
func (w *NpuV1Worker) CreateVDevice(uniqueID int32, coreNum string) (VDeviceInfo, error) {
    deviceID, cardID, err := w.FindDevice(uniqueID)
    if err != nil {
        return VDeviceInfo{CardID: -1, DeviceID: -1, VdeviceID: -1}, err
    }
    vdevId, err := w.DcMgr.DcCreateVDevice(cardID, deviceID, coreNum)
    if err != nil {
        return VDeviceInfo{CardID: -1, DeviceID: -1, VdeviceID: math.MaxInt32}, err
    }
    if vdevId > math.MaxInt32 {
        return VDeviceInfo{CardID: cardID, DeviceID: deviceID, VdeviceID: math.MaxInt32},
            fmt.Errorf("create virtual device failed, vdeviceId too large")
    }
    return VDeviceInfo{CardID: cardID, DeviceID: deviceID, VdeviceID: int32(vdevId)}, nil
}

逐行解析

  1. FindDevice --- 将物理ID转换为cardID+deviceID
  2. DcCreateVDevice --- 调用CGO创建虚拟设备
  3. 溢出检查:vdevId > math.MaxInt32
  4. 返回完整的VDeviceInfo

3.10 NpuV2Worker.CreateVDevice

go 复制代码
func (a *NpuV2Worker) CreateVDevice(uniqueID int32, coreNum string) (VDeviceInfo, error) {
    vdevId, err := a.DcMgr.DcCreateVDevice(uniqueID, coreNum)
    if err != nil {
        return VDeviceInfo{
            CardID:    -1,
            DeviceID:  -1,
            VdeviceID: -1,
        }, err
    }
    return VDeviceInfo{VdeviceID: vdevId}, nil
}

注意 :V2的 DcCreateVDevice 实际返回错误("ascend 950 not support virtual device"),所以这段代码在当前版本实际上不会成功执行。


四、dcManager.go 逐行解析(294行)

4.1 CGO导入

go 复制代码
// #cgo LDFLAGS: -ldl
// #include "dcmi_interface_api.h"
import "C"
  • LDFLAGS: -ldl --- 链接动态加载库(dlopen)
  • #include "dcmi_interface_api.h" --- DCMI C接口头文件
  • import "C" --- Go的CGO机制,允许调用C函数

4.2 DcV1Manager.DcInitialize

go 复制代码
func (d *DcV1Manager) DcInitialize() error {
    cDlPath := C.CString(string(make([]byte, int32(C.PATH_MAX))))
    defer C.free(unsafe.Pointer(cDlPath))
    if err := C.DcmiInitDl(cDlPath); err != C.SUCCESS {
        errInfo := fmt.Errorf("dcmi lib load failed, error code: %d", int32(err))
        return errInfo
    }
    dlPath := C.GoString(cDlPath)
    if _, err := mindxcheckutils.RealFileChecker(dlPath, true, false, mindxcheckutils.DefaultSize); err != nil {
        return err
    }
    if err := C.DcmiInit(); err != C.SUCCESS {
        errInfo := fmt.Errorf("dcmi init failed, error code: %d", int32(err))
        return errInfo
    }
    return nil
}

逐行解析

  1. make([]byte, C.PATH_MAX) --- 创建PATH_MAX长度的空字节切片
  2. C.CString --- 转换为C字符串(用于接收dcmi库路径输出)
  3. C.DcmiInitDl(cDlPath) --- 动态加载libdcmi.so(dlopen方式),路径通过cDlPath返回
  4. defer C.free --- 释放C字符串内存(防内存泄漏)
  5. C.GoString(cDlPath) --- 将C字符串转回Go字符串
  6. RealFileChecker --- 安全校验加载的dcmi库文件
  7. C.DcmiInit() --- 初始化dcmi设备管理连接

设计意图:两步初始化------先加载动态库(dlopen),再初始化设备连接。安全校验确保加载的是合法dcmi库。

4.3 DcV1Manager.DcGetCardList

go 复制代码
func (d *DcV1Manager) DcGetCardList() (int32, []int32, error) {
    var ids [hiAIMaxCardNum]C.int
    var cNum C.int
    if err := C.DcmiGetCardNumList(&cNum, &ids[0], hiAIMaxCardNum); err != 0 {
        return retError, nil, fmt.Errorf("get card list failed, error code: %d", int32(err))
    }
    if cNum <= 0 || cNum > hiAIMaxCardNum {
        return retError, nil, fmt.Errorf("get error card quantity: %d", int32(cNum))
    }
    var cardNum = int32(cNum)
    var cardIDList []int32
    for i := int32(0); i < cardNum; i++ {
        cardID := int32(ids[i])
        if cardID < 0 {
            continue
        }
        cardIDList = append(cardIDList, cardID)
    }
    return cardNum, cardIDList, nil
}

逐行解析

  1. 声明C数组 ids[64] 和数量 cNum
  2. C.DcmiGetCardNumList --- C函数填充卡数量和卡ID列表
  3. 校验数量:1 ≤ cNum ≤ 64
  4. 遍历C数组,过滤负值,转为Go的\[\]int32

4.4 DcV1Manager.DcCreateVDevice

go 复制代码
func (d *DcV1Manager) DcCreateVDevice(cardID, deviceID int32, coreNum string) (int32, error) {
    var createInfo C.struct_DcmiCreateVdevOut
    createInfo.vdevId = C.uint(math.MaxUint32)
    var deviceCreateStr C.struct_DcmiCreateVdevResStru
    deviceCreateStr = C.struct_DcmiCreateVdevResStru{
        vdevId: C.uint(vfgID),
        vfgId:  C.uint(vfgID),
    }
    deviceCreateStrArr := [coreNumLen]C.char{0}
    for i := 0; i < len(coreNum); i++ {
        if i >= coreNumLen {
            return math.MaxInt32, fmt.Errorf("wrong template")
        }
        deviceCreateStrArr[i] = C.char(coreNum[i])
    }
    deviceCreateStr.templateName = deviceCreateStrArr
    ret := C.DcmiCreateVdevice(C.int(cardID), C.int(deviceID), &deviceCreateStr, &createInfo)
    if ret != 0 {
        return math.MaxInt32, fmt.Errorf("create virtual device failed, error code: %d", int32(ret))
    }
    return int32(createInfo.vdevId), nil
}

逐行解析

  1. 创建输出结构体 DcmiCreateVdevOut,初始vdevId设为MaxUint32(表示未创建)
  2. 创建输入结构体 DcmiCreateVdevResStru,设置vdevId和vfgId为默认值(0xFFFFFFFF)
  3. 将切分模板名(如"vir04")逐字节复制到C字符数组
  4. 模板名长度校验(≤32)
  5. 调用 C.DcmiCreateVdevice --- CGO调用创建虚拟设备
  6. 返回创建的vdevId

4.5 DcV1Manager.DcGetChipInfo

go 复制代码
func (d *DcV1Manager) DcGetChipInfo(cardID, deviceID int32) (*ChipInfo, error) {
    if !isValidCardIDAndDeviceID(cardID, deviceID) {
        return nil, fmt.Errorf("cardID(%d) or deviceID(%d) is invalid", cardID, deviceID)
    }
    var chipInfo C.struct_DcmiChipInfo
    if rCode := C.DcmiGetDeviceChipInfo(C.int(cardID), C.int(deviceID), &chipInfo); int32(rCode) != 0 {
        return nil, fmt.Errorf("get device ChipInfo information failed, ...")
    }

    name := convertUCharToCharArr(chipInfo.chipName)
    cType := convertUCharToCharArr(chipInfo.chipType)
    ver := convertUCharToCharArr(chipInfo.chipVer)

    chip := &ChipInfo{
        Name:    string(name),
        Type:    string(cType),
        Version: string(ver),
    }
    if !isValidChipInfo(chip) {
        return nil, fmt.Errorf("get device ChipInfo information failed, chip info is empty, ...")
    }

    return chip, nil
}

逐行解析

  1. 参数校验(cardID和deviceID范围检查)
  2. 声明C结构体 DcmiChipInfo
  3. 调用 C.DcmiGetDeviceChipInfo 获取芯片信息
  4. convertUCharToCharArr --- 将C的uchar数组转为Go byte切片(遇0截断)
  5. 构造Go的ChipInfo结构体
  6. 有效性校验

4.6 convertUCharToCharArr --- C数组转Go

go 复制代码
func convertUCharToCharArr(cgoArr [maxChipNameLen]C.uchar) []byte {
    var charArr []byte
    for _, v := range cgoArr {
        if v == 0 {
            break
        }
        charArr = append(charArr, byte(v))
    }
    return charArr
}
  • C字符串以null(0)结尾,遍历到0即停止
  • 将C的[32]uchar转为Go的[]byte,再转为string

4.7 DcV2Manager --- V2 CGO实现

go 复制代码
func (d *DcV2Manager) DcInitialize() error {
    // ...同V1的DcmiInitDl...
    if err := C.DcmiV2Init(); err != C.SUCCESS {
        return fmt.Errorf("dcmi init failed, error code: %d", int32(err))
    }
    return nil
}

关键差异 :V2调用 C.DcmiV2Init() 而非 C.DcmiInit()

go 复制代码
func (d *DcV2Manager) DcCreateVDevice(deviceID int32, coreNum string) (int32, error) {
    return -1, fmt.Errorf("create error, ascend 950 not support virtual device")
}

func (d *DcV2Manager) DcDestroyVDevice(deviceID int32, vDevID int32) error {
    return fmt.Errorf("destroy error, ascend 950 not support virtual device")
}

V2不支持虚拟设备:Ascend 950(910A5)不支持vNPU切分,直接返回错误。

go 复制代码
func (d *DcV2Manager) DcGetDeviceList() (int32, []int32, error) {
    var ids [hiAIMaxCardNum]C.int
    var cNum C.int
    if err := C.DcmiV2GetDeviceList(&ids[0], &cNum, hiAIMaxCardNum); err != 0 {
        return retError, nil, fmt.Errorf("get device list failed, error code: %d", int32(err))
    }
    // ...校验+转换...
    return deviceNum, deviceIDList, nil
}

V2直接获取设备列表,无需先获取卡列表再遍历卡内设备。

对比维度 V1 (DcV1Manager) V2 (DcV2Manager)
初始化 DcmiInitDl + DcmiInit DcmiInitDl + DcmiV2Init
设备寻址 cardID + deviceID 二级 deviceID 一级
获取设备列表 DcmiGetCardNumList → 遍历卡 → DcmiGetDeviceNumInCard DcmiV2GetDeviceList 一步到位
芯片信息 DcmiGetDeviceChipInfo(cardID, deviceID) DcmiV2GetDeviceChipInfo(deviceID)
产品类型 支持 DcmiGetProductType 不支持(返回"not support")
vNPU切分 支持 DcmiCreateVdevice 不支持(返回错误)
物理ID转换 需要 DcmiGetDeviceLogicidFromPhyid 不需要
适用芯片 Ascend 910, 310, 310P, 310B Ascend 910B, A5 (950)
